Transponder Keys

Many of the newer Audi models come with a key fob which uses a transponder chip to transmit an identification signal when inserted into the ignition. This technology has decreased the risk of auto theft and is a great way to ensure the security of your vehicle. Unfortunately, just like any other electronic device the ones that are connected to your car are not impervious to damage. In some cases physical damage or malfunctioning chip may require a new device.

When you select the best locksmith, replacing a damaged or lost Audi transponder is a simple procedure. A reliable locksmith will be able to cut and program a brand-new car key for your vehicle right on the spot. This is far more convenient than having to wait for the dealership to cut the key, and also considerably less expensive.

Audi introduced transponder keys into their automobiles in the early 1990s. The keys contain a microchip inside the head of the key that sends unique signals when inserted into your car's ignition. The signal is then read by the vehicle's computer and if the data is compatible, it will allow the engine to begin.

The benefit of this technology is that the transponder's algorithm is constantly changing making it more difficult to duplicate or hack. This technology has drastically decreased the incidence of car thefts, specifically for luxury cars that are expensive.

The disadvantage is that transponder keys can be difficult to manage if you are prone to losing them. Key Fobs

Modern cars come with key fobs that can be used to unlock and even start your vehicle. Fobs have proximity sensors that communicate with the car in order to activate its systems. The sensor on the fob's key will send out a signal to identify you as the owner. The immobiliser chip is activated so you can start the car. It is not possible to start the car or get back in the car if you've lost your Audi keys.

The newer keys require more complex programming than traditional metal keys. They must be programmed to work with your car. This is only done by a locksmith or dealer with the appropriate equipment to program the newer models of automobiles.

The price of a fob is usually more expensive than a traditional metal key. This is due to the fact that they are typically more complex and require more technology. It can also be more expensive to replace the fob if it is damaged or lost.

Smart Keys

Audi's smart key technology has taken car keys up an notch. The wireless keys, unlike traditional metal keys, are equipped with proximity sensors that allow motorists to lock and unlock their cars without touching any button. This is a here great benefit for those who have mobility issues, children, and any other person who has difficulty reaching the traditional keys to their vehicles.

In addition to their convenience, these Audi smart keys also offer security features that help keep them more secure from thieves with a technological edge. While standard key fobs broadcast the same frequency signal every time the driver opens or closes their doors smart keys broadcast encrypted signals that are specific to each trunk and door. Open Road Auto Group reports that this helps prevent theft because it makes it impossible for thieves guess the code and hijack the vehicle.

Smart keys can also be used to start more info a car even when they're not in the ignition. This feature comes in handy when you're loading groceries or kids, or other large items into your vehicle, or when you're wearing gloves and don't want remove your glove to reach for your keys.
